Chrome does not handle 408 response in HTTP2

Issue descriptionUser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10_12_3)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/56.0.2924.87 Safari/537.36 Example URL: Steps to reproduce the problem: 1. Enable HTTP2 in Apache Tomcat 2. Create a test jsp 3. Set response status as 408 4. Open jsp in chrome What is the expected behavior? Request should end properly What went wrong? Request loops infinitely until close the tab Did this work before? N/A Chrome version: 56.0.2924.87 Channel: stable OS Version: OS X 10.12.3 Flash Version: Shockwave Flash 24.0 r0
